Our series on presentation and disclosure continues with a focus on equity method investments and consolidation.
Our Full disclosure podcast series brings you back to the basics on all things related to financial statement presentation and disclosure, from the top of the financial statements through the footnotes.
This week we focus on equity method investments and consolidation matters—think majority interests and variable interest entities (VIEs). Matt Sabatini, PwC National Office partner, is back again to share helpful insights and key reminders.
Topics include:
  • 1:12 - Consolidation. Matt and Heather begin with an overview of the purpose of, and requirements for, consolidated financial statements.
  • 11:04 - Variable interest entities. Matt and Heather tackle VIEs first—how are they presented? What are the disclosure objectives and requirements? Our guest also explains what’s different if you’re not the primary beneficiary.
  • 22:25 - Other consolidation considerations. Matt dives into a few exceptions to the rules, common SEC comments, and other considerations.
  • 30:46 - Equity method investments. Not required to consolidate? Matt describes the presentation and disclosure objectives and requirements for equity method investments.
  • 45:06 - Other key reminders. Matt gives more reminders for preparing equity method investment disclosures and offers some final words of advice.
